Night-Shift Access — Support Team

Applies to Helmsley Court, floors 2–4. Main doors lock at 21:00. Enter via the east vestibule; badge in at the inner reader. Lifts run on night mode — badge required per trip. Report reader faults to the facilities desk log. If your badge fails at the vestibule, use the fallback code below.

turnstile pass: bdg-FVNQRS-72965873

## Configuration

BounceSift reads all settings from a `.env` file loaded at process start; nothing is read from the shell environment afterward. Reviewers should note that the IMAP poller, the classification worker, and the suppression-list writer each validate their required variables on boot and refuse to start if any are missing. File permissions on `.env` must be 0600, owned by the `bouncesift` service user. The final line of the file sets the suppression API secret, as shown below.

env line for fafof-fahag: LEDGER_TOKEN5=f8790

## Changelog — DropCourier 3.2

**Changed defaults for partner SFTP drops.** Hey, if you're new here: DropCourier is how our partners at the fictional Marrowgate exchange push files to us. We used to default to hourly polling with a 30-minute stale-file grace window, which caused double-pickups all over the place. As of 3.2, polling, grace windows, and archive behavior have saner defaults. Existing deployments keep their overrides, but fresh installs (probably what you're setting up) now start with these values:

settings of tagef-bawif:
DRUIX_HOST=druix.zemvarlabs.internal
DRUIX_PORT=8000

For the weekly eng sync: we identified configuration drift between the Meridly sync workers in the Holtsford and Braywick regions. Holtsford workers were updated to the new conflict-resolution policy (last-writer-wins with tombstone checks), while Braywick still runs the legacy merge behavior. The result is duplicate and ghost events for tenants whose calendars replicate across both regions. Remediation is to re-pin Braywick to the shared baseline and redeploy. The baseline configuration that both regions should converge on is shown below.

settings of yadup-tajef:
[pelys]
team = raleth
access_code = ac_67f5a1
host = pelys.olvarqlabs.local
port = 8080
owner = pramir.pramir
peer = rusir.qirvanio.corp